Herb Spirals

spiral garden design concept

Creating an herb spiral can revolutionize how I grow my culinary herbs.

This spiral design maximizes space and allows for diverse herb selection, catering to varying sunlight and moisture needs.

By planting herbs like basil at the top and mint at the bottom, I ensure each plant thrives.

The result? A visually stunning and functional garden that enhances my cooking experience.

Pollinator Gardens

attracting essential pollinator species

Pollinator gardens are vital havens for bees, butterflies, and other essential creatures that support our ecosystem.

By focusing on native plant selection, I create diverse pollinator habitats that provide food and shelter.

Plants like milkweed, coneflowers, and asters attract various species, ensuring a thriving environment.

Embracing this approach not only enhances biodiversity but also fosters a deeper connection to nature in my own backyard.

Rain Gardens

sustainable stormwater management solution

Creating a rain garden not only enhances my landscape but also plays a crucial role in managing stormwater runoff.

By incorporating native plants, I boost biodiversity while ensuring my garden thrives. This space becomes a hub for rainwater harvesting, capturing runoff effectively.

I feel fulfilled knowing my efforts contribute to environmental health, making my garden both beautiful and functional.

Vertical Hydroponics

soil less vertical farming system

While exploring innovative gardening methods, I've discovered that vertical hydroponics offers a fantastic way to maximize space and grow fresh produce.

These hydroponic systems utilize nutrient solutions to nourish plants without soil, allowing for efficient growth.

I love how they can fit into small areas, making it possible to enjoy fresh vegetables and herbs right at home, regardless of garden size.
